The good thing about Spritz is that it takes out the slowest part of reading - moving your eyes. Understanding the words was never really the bottleneck for quick reading - it was actually having to physically move your eyes and find the letters and the words. There are cool methods to improve reading speed (quick reading, etc.), but this eliminates the need for all those methods, because it's quicker than any of them.
